Tip 2: Master Design Tools Early On
Interior design today is digital. Learning design software early will save you hours during final projects. Focus on:
- SketchUp: for 3D modeling
- Photoshop: for presentations and mood boards
- Revit: for building information modeling

Tip 5: Practice Sketching Every Day
Sketching is the language of designers. Even simple sketches help you express ideas quickly. Try:
- 10-minute daily sketch challenges
- Drawing furniture, layouts, or textures
- Keeping a sketchbook with date-wise entries

Tip 8: Build Your Portfolio as You Study
Don’t wait till the final semester to start your portfolio. Begin now. Include:
- Class assignments
- Sketches and mood boards
- Software renderings
- Real-world projects
